VPI does check preexisting conditions and is the only ins. in the US that I know of for pets. Petco and Petsmart have 'plans' but they didnt lok very good to us.
Parker is about $20 a month for us to insure with additional routine care coverage. It does not prepay, you pay and then submit your claim but you can go to any vet.

No pre existing condition check here either. It costs more to insure some breeds including Boxer, Chow, Dobe, GPyr, Irish Wolfhound, Newfs, Old ESheepdog, Rottie, Schnauzers, St Benard, Airdales, Bull Terriers, Bulldog Breeds, Bassets, Bouvier, Great Dane and Mastiff Breeds. Full premium coverage here costs $56.45 to $74.85 per month.
